Subject: [PATCH 11/17] last: parse easy to use time formats

Signed-off-by: Sami Kerola <kerolasa@iki.fi>
---
login-utils/Makemodule.am | 1 +
login-utils/last.c | 12 ++++++++++--
2 files changed, 11 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/login-utils/Makemodule.am b/login-utils/Makemodule.am
index 8d65cc5..d382ccc 100644
--- a/login-utils/Makemodule.am
+++ b/login-utils/Makemodule.am
@@ -5,6 +5,7 @@ dist_man_MANS += \
login-utils/last.1 \
login-utils/lastb.1
last_SOURCES = login-utils/last.c lib/strutils.c
+last_LDADD = $(LDADD) libcommon.la
install-exec-hook-last:
cd $(DESTDIR)$(usrsbin_execdir) && ln -sf last lastb
diff --git a/login-utils/last.c b/login-utils/last.c
index 3367038..df78436 100644
--- a/login-utils/last.c
+++ b/login-utils/last.c
@@ -47,6 +47,7 @@
#include "closestream.h"
#include "carefulputc.h"
#include "strutils.h"
+#include "time-util.h"
#ifndef SHUTDOWN_TIME
# define SHUTDOWN_TIME 254
@@ -735,6 +736,7 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
time_t until = 0; /* at what time to stop parsing the file */
time_t present = 0; /* who where present at time_t */
+ usec_t p;
static const struct option long_opts[] = {
{ "limit", required_argument, NULL, 'n' },
@@ -795,13 +797,19 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
break;
case 'p':
present = parsetm(optarg);
- if (present == (time_t) -1)
+ if (present != (time_t) -1)
+ break;
+ if (parse_timestamp(optarg, &p) < 0)
errx(EXIT_FAILURE, _("invalid time value \"%s\""), optarg);
+ present = (time_t) (p / 1000000);
break;
case 't':
until = parsetm(optarg);
- if (until == (time_t) -1)
+ if (until != (time_t) -1)
+ break;
+ if (parse_timestamp(optarg, &p) < 0)
errx(EXIT_FAILURE, _("invalid time value \"%s\""), optarg);
+ until = (time_t) (p / 1000000);
break;
case 'w':
if (UT_NAMESIZE > name_len)
